What's the best time of year to travel to Lebanon with my pet?
When you travel with your pet, keeping tabs on the weather can help you make the trip more safe and fun for everyone. The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 21°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 1°C. Average annual precipitation for Lebanon is 1171 mm.
What is there to see and do with your pet in Lebanon?
Known for its monuments and churches, Lebanon has lots to offer visitors, including its natural beauty, baseball and opera. See the local sights and visit Lebanon Valley Mall and Union Canal Tunnel Park. While you’re there, make sure you don’t miss Lebanon Valley Exposition Center & Fairgrounds and Royal Oaks Golf Course.
